I cannot say enough good things about Allegri Electric!
We have a 123 yr old home in Santa Cruz, with very old wiring. When our power randomly cut out, we mistakenly called PG&E first (hot tip don't do that. Call Allegri first!).
PG&E came out and were extremely rude about the very old electrical set up in our home. They had discovered the line into the house from the pole had apparently started to come loose from the storms, arced, and burned up. We're lucky the house didn't catch fire. PG&E shut power off at the pole, and took our smart meter they had installed in what we were now told was an illegal panel location in our home 6 yrs prior.
We immediately called Allegri for an estimate. Lori in the office was incredibly kind and responsive. Jordan and his partner were on the scene within 45 mins to access! Both Jordan and partner (I'm sorry for not catching his name) were extremely kind, knowledgeable, communicative, and reassuring. After getting other bids, we chose Allegri not only for the price, but for the professionalism.
Jordan and partner were on site only a few hours later, emergency permits in hand and a city inspection already scheduled for the very next morning! They knocked out moving our panel from inside to outside, repairing wiring, installing grounding rods etc - in 2 HOURS! We were blown away.
The city came for inspection at 9am the next day as promised and we were in the clear. Then PG&E did everything they could besides their job for the next 7 days.
Jordan and Lori were on the phone multiple times a day fighting PG&E over a multitude of ridiculous reasons PG&E came up with. Jordan had to come back 4x to take pictures of their work to submit.
